Conquer Burnout: Support and Treatment
Burnout is a serious problem that can affect anyone. It's characterized by feelings of fatigue, cynicism, and a diminished sense of accomplishment. If you're feeling overwhelmed and unable to cope, it's important to seek support and treatment.
There are many resources available to help you navigate burnout. Initially, talk to your healthcare provider. They can help identify any underlying medical conditions that may be contributing to your symptoms and can prescribe treatment options.
In addition to medical treatment, consider these strategies to manage burnout:
* Focus on self-care activities like movement.
* Set healthy boundaries at work and in your daily life.
* Practice mindfulness or meditation to manage stress.
* Nurture relationships with friends.
Remember, burnout is not a sign of weakness. It's a common response to stress. By accepting support and implementing healthy coping mechanisms, you can recover.
